Patents Assigned to Axis AB
  • Patent number: 11917536
    Abstract: A method is described for initiating a wireless network to connect an electronic device among a set of first-type electronic devices with a second-type electronic device. The method comprising: receiving, at a service server configured to service the set of first-type electronic devices, data pertaining to a user-id; retrieving, from a database, a unique network configuration associated with the user-id, wherein the unique network configuration is known beforehand by the second-type electronic device; selecting, at the service server, an electronic device among the set of first-type electronic devices; and sending, to the selected electronic device, the unique network configuration associated with the user-id for allowing the selected electronic device to initiate a wireless network using the unique network configuration associated with the user-id.
    Type: Grant
    Filed: October 6, 2021
    Date of Patent: February 27, 2024
    Assignee: AXIS AB
    Inventors: Magnus Eriksson, Stefan Andersson, Marcus Prebble, Philip Linde, Filip Björck, Björn Holmstedt, Tommy Stahlros, Hamoud Abdullah, Johan Helmertz
  • Patent number: 11909718
    Abstract: Methods for configuring a monitoring device to communicate with a service server are provided. The method includes the monitoring device sending a message including a monitoring device identifier used by a control server to identify the service server associated with the monitoring device, receiving one or more service server addresses associated with the identified service sever from the control server, and establishing a service connection between the monitoring device and the identified service server using the one or more addresses received from the control server. A control server adapted to configure a monitoring device in a monitoring system and a method for configuring the control server are also provided.
    Type: Grant
    Filed: February 24, 2023
    Date of Patent: February 20, 2024
    Assignee: Axis AB
    Inventors: Joacim Tullberg, Johan Adolfsson, Martin Gren
  • Publication number: 20240054598
    Abstract: A method for defining an outline of a region in an image having distorted lines comprises displaying a first image version having distorted lines, wherein lines in a first image portion of the first version have a reduced distortion, receiving user input defining a first outline portion of the outline of region in the first version, wherein the first outline portion includes one or more lines in the first image portion of the first version, displaying a further version of the image having distorted lines, wherein lines in a further image portion of the further version have a reduced distortion, and receiving user input defining a further outline portion of the outline of the region in the further, wherein the further outline portion includes one or more lines in the further portion of the further version.
    Type: Application
    Filed: July 20, 2023
    Publication date: February 15, 2024
    Applicant: Axis AB
    Inventor: Song YUAN
  • Patent number: 11875671
    Abstract: A controller for reading both an RS485 data signal and a Wiegand data signal from a user connector having two output ports. The controller comprises an RS485 transceiver with two input ports, each of which is connected to a respective one of the two output ports of the user connector or reading one data signal on each of the output ports from the user connector, and an output port for providing an RS485 data signal that is defined by the data signals read on the two output ports. The controller comprises an RS485 interface for receiving the RS485 data signal, and a Wiegand interface for receiving the RS485 data signal and a data ready port connected to the two input ports via a first logic circuit for determining whether the RS485 data signal is to be read as a Wiegand data signal or not on the Wiegand data port.
    Type: Grant
    Filed: January 7, 2022
    Date of Patent: January 16, 2024
    Assignee: AXIS AB
    Inventor: Daniel Björkman
  • Patent number: 11874721
    Abstract: A method of operating a hardware accelerator comprises: implementing a multi-layer neural network using the hardware accelerator; measuring a power consumption of the hardware accelerator while executing a predefined operation on the multi-layer network at a default clock frequency; evaluating one or more power management criteria for the measured power consumption; and, in response to exceeding one of the power management criteria, deciding to reduce the clock frequency relative to the default clock frequency. In the step of measuring a power consumption of the hardware accelerator, per-layer measurements which each relate to fewer than all layers of the neural network may be captured.
    Type: Grant
    Filed: July 12, 2022
    Date of Patent: January 16, 2024
    Assignee: AXIS AB
    Inventor: Anton Jakobsson
  • Publication number: 20240015307
    Abstract: A method encodes image frames of an image stream and transmits encoded image frames on a communications network. The method includes receiving and then dividing an image frame into multiple slices defined by first slice parameters and second slice parameters. The method also includes prioritizing the multiple slices and then generating a first encoded image frame having first encoded slices, second encoded slices and one or more first skip blocks. The method then generates and transmits a second encoded image frame having further second encoded slices defined by the second slice parameters and based on encoding second slices and further first encoded slices defined by the first slice parameters with more second skip blocks.
    Type: Application
    Filed: June 28, 2023
    Publication date: January 11, 2024
    Applicant: Axis AB
    Inventors: Viktor EDPALM, Mattias PETTERSSON
  • Publication number: 20240005516
    Abstract: A method for tracking an object in a scene is provided, including receiving a first image frame of a first image stream capturing a scene; detecting or tracking a first object in the first image frame, and determining that the first object is in a first part of the first image frame; determining, using object detection, that the first object belongs to a first object class; determining, based on multiple values of a tracking parameter each specific for different parts of the first image frame and for different object classes, a first value of the tracking parameter for the first part of the first image and for the first object class, and tracking the first object in a second image frame of the first image stream subsequent to the first image frame, based on the first value of the tracking parameter.
    Type: Application
    Filed: June 26, 2023
    Publication date: January 4, 2024
    Applicant: Axis AB
    Inventors: ANTON ÖHRN, Johan Sternby, Amanda Nilsson
  • Publication number: 20240007299
    Abstract: A device, a non-transitory computer-readable storage medium, and a method of signing a metadata frame corresponding to an image frame of a sequence of image frames are disclosed. The metadata frame comprises metadata of one or more detected objects in the image frame, and the metadata of each detected object comprises coordinates defining a location in the image frame of the detected object. A digital signature is generated based on at least a subset of the metadata in the metadata frame, and additional metadata are added to the metadata frame. The additional metadata comprise the digital signature and predefined coordinates which define that the additional metadata comprise the digital signature. Furthermore, a device, a non-transitory computer-readable storage medium, and method of authenticating a digitally signed metadata frame corresponding to an image frame of a sequence of image frames are disclosed.
    Type: Application
    Filed: May 3, 2023
    Publication date: January 4, 2024
    Applicant: Axis AB
    Inventors: Xing Danielsson FAN, Niclas DANIELSSON
  • Publication number: 20240005460
    Abstract: A method of distortion correction in an image captured by a non-rectilinear camera includes obtaining multiple images of a scene captured by the camera over time, determining where bottom portions of objects having moved over a horizontal surface in the scene are located in the images, determining a boundary of the horizontal surface in the scene based on the determined locations of the bottom portions, generating a three-dimensional model of the scene by defining one or more vertical surfaces around the determined boundary of the horizontal surface of the scene, and correcting a distortion of at least one of the images by projecting the image onto the three-dimensional model of the scene. A corresponding device, computer program and computer program product are also provided.
    Type: Application
    Filed: May 31, 2023
    Publication date: January 4, 2024
    Applicant: Axis AB
    Inventors: Joakim ERICSON, Song YUAN, Johan STENING
  • Publication number: 20230417599
    Abstract: A device for monitoring a heap of material, comprises circuitry for executing a plurality of functions. A region of interest function, in a thermal video stream captured by a thermal video camera, defines a region of interest covering the heap of material. A reference spatial property setting function, from pixels within a video frame of the thermal video stream, determines a spatial property of the heap of material; and sets the determined spatial property as a reference spatial property. A region of interest adjusting function determines a respective sample spatial property for regions in the thermal video stream; and adjusts the region of interest such that regions exhibiting a sample spatial property above a threshold are included by the region of interest. A temperature monitoring function over time and within the region of interest, monitors a temperature measure; and if it exceeds a predetermined threshold, generates an alarm event.
    Type: Application
    Filed: May 16, 2023
    Publication date: December 28, 2023
    Applicant: Axis AB
    Inventors: Thomas WINZELL, Ann-Sofie Rase, Jesper Bengtsson, Tuong Lam
  • Publication number: 20230419508
    Abstract: A device and method for detecting objects crossing a crossline, and the direction, captured by a video camera are described. A sequence of video image frames of the scene is captured, and a combined image frame is created by extracting two or more lines of pixels of each image frame and arranging them adjacent to each other, wherein the lines of pixels of each video image frame are parallel and correspond to the crossline in the scene. The combined image frame is sent to a machine learning model that detects a combined image frame representing an object crossing a crossline and a direction the object crosses during capturing of the sequence of video image frames. A detection of any object crossing the crossline and a direction of crossing is received from the machine learning model.
    Type: Application
    Filed: May 31, 2023
    Publication date: December 28, 2023
    Applicant: Axis AB
    Inventor: Martin Sjöborg
  • Publication number: 20230410352
    Abstract: A method and control unit for object detection in a video stream captured with an image acquisition device, especially for the purpose of anonymizing objects in the video stream.
    Type: Application
    Filed: June 13, 2023
    Publication date: December 21, 2023
    Applicant: Axis AB
    Inventors: Ludvig HASSBRING, Song YUAN
  • Publication number: 20230412815
    Abstract: An image processing device, a camera system, a non-transitory computer-readable storage medium, and methods for encoding two video image frames captured by one of two image sensors, wherein each of the video image frames depicts a respective portion of a scene. A respective overlapping area is identified in each of the video image frames, which overlapping areas both depict a same sub-portion of the scene, and a video image frame of the video image frames is selected. Compression levels are then set for the image frames, wherein respective compression levels are set for pixel blocks in the selected video image frame based on a given principle. Respective compression levels for pixel blocks in the overlapping area in the selected video image frame are selectively set higher or lower than respective compression levels that would have been set based on the given principle. The video image frames are then encoded.
    Type: Application
    Filed: June 1, 2023
    Publication date: December 21, 2023
    Applicant: Axis AB
    Inventors: Axel KESKIKANGAS, Song YUAN, Viktor EDPALM
  • Patent number: 11847765
    Abstract: The present disclosure relates to cameras and in particular methods for noise reduction in images captured by a camera, wherein a same perspective transform may be reused for performing temporal noise filtering on a plurality of images.
    Type: Grant
    Filed: March 24, 2021
    Date of Patent: December 19, 2023
    Assignee: AXIS AB
    Inventor: Song Yuan
  • Publication number: 20230403472
    Abstract: A method of controlling a guard tour of a thermal camera, wherein the thermal camera is a pan-tilt camera or a pan-tilt-zoom camera, comprises the steps of: obtaining a guard tour comprising a plurality of views of an area or facility and a sequence of movements and/or view times of the thermal camera for traversing the plurality of views; controlling the thermal camera to traverse the plurality of views according to the sequence of movements and view times of the guard tour; for each view: extracting a temperature profile based on thermal images from the thermal camera; based on the temperature profile, estimating whether an increased risk of overheating or overcooling exists for the view; and if so, adjusting the sequence of movements and view times of the thermal camera to show the view having an increased risk of overheating or overcooling more frequently.
    Type: Application
    Filed: April 25, 2023
    Publication date: December 14, 2023
    Applicant: Axis AB
    Inventors: Jörgen JÖNSSON, Thomas WINZELL
  • Publication number: 20230403462
    Abstract: A method for providing data from a network camera performed in a processing unit of a portable device having a physical communication interface, whereby the portable device has been associated with the network camera. The method comprises: upon detecting a connection to a connected client device at the physical communication interface, establishing a connection to the associated network camera using association data that have been received from the associated network camera when the portable device became associated with the network camera; receiving data from the network camera via the established connection; and transmitting the received data to the connected client device. A portable device and a system of a portable device and a network camera are also disclosed.
    Type: Application
    Filed: June 1, 2023
    Publication date: December 14, 2023
    Applicant: Axis AB
    Inventor: Mats LUND
  • Publication number: 20230397357
    Abstract: A cable retention arrangement for an electronic device, such as a surveillance camera, comprises a base member and an attachment member releasably attachable to the base member. The base member is provided with a channel configured to receive a cable and arranged in a surface of the base member configured to face the attachment member in an assembled state of the cable retention arrangement in which the attachment member is attached to the base member. The channel extends between a cable entry and a cable exit and the attachment member is provided with a slit which, in the assembled state of the cable retention arrangement, is configured to extend in a direction traversing the channel such that the cable exit of the channel is defined at the intersection of the channel and the slit. The disclosure further relates to an electronic device comprising such a cable retention arrangement.
    Type: Application
    Filed: May 4, 2023
    Publication date: December 7, 2023
    Applicant: Axis AB
    Inventors: Åke SÖDERGÅRD, Henrik PERSSON, Joel NILSSON, Malte BOKVIST
  • Publication number: 20230394824
    Abstract: A system and techniques for detecting a reflection of an object in a sequence of image frames. Objects of a given type are detected in the sequence of image frames, and a detection score is determined for each detected object. Distance ratios between unfiltered object position indicators identified for each detected object are determined. A displacement factor is determined for each detected object between a current location of the detected object and a previous location of the detected object. One of the two detected objects which has a lower detection score is a reflection of the other of the two detected objects is determined in response to finding a match between normalized sizes and normalized movements of the detected objects.
    Type: Application
    Filed: May 24, 2023
    Publication date: December 7, 2023
    Applicant: Axis AB
    Inventors: Ludvig HASSBRING, Song YUAN
  • Patent number: D1007562
    Type: Grant
    Filed: October 7, 2021
    Date of Patent: December 12, 2023
    Assignee: AXIS AB
    Inventors: Ola Andersson, Kim Nordkvist, Johan Bergsten, Johan Widerdal, Jakob Holmquist, Jonas Sjögren, Sebastian Engwall, Mariano Vozzi, Christian Jacobsson, Mikael Persson
  • Patent number: D1013761
    Type: Grant
    Filed: August 24, 2020
    Date of Patent: February 6, 2024
    Assignee: AXIS AB
    Inventors: Alexander Rosenkvist, Jonas Sjögren, Markus Carlsson